Dynamic modeling of a hose-drogue aerial refueling system(HDARS)and an integral sliding mode backstepping controller design for the hose whipping phenomenon(HWP)during probe-drogue coupling are studied.Firstly,a dynamic model of the variable-length hose-drogue assembly is built for the sake of exploiting suppression methods for the whipping phenomenon.Based on the lumped parameter method,the hose is modeled by a series of variable-length links connected with frictionless joints.A set of iterative equations of the hose's three-dimensional motion is derived subject to hose reeling in/out,tanker motion,gravity,and aerodynamic loads accounting for the effects of steady wind,atmospheric turbulence,and tanker wake.Secondly,relying on a permanent magnet synchronous motor and high-precision position sensors,a new active control strategy for the HWP on the basis of the relative position between the tanker and the receiver is proposed.Considering the strict-feedback configuration of the permanent magnet synchronous motor,a rotor position control law based on the backstepping method is designed to insure global stability.An integral of the rotor position error and an exponential sliding mode reaching law of the current errors are applied to enhance control accuracy and robustness.Finally,the simulation results show the effectiveness of the proposed model and control laws. 展开更多

Rules of Classification Societies all around the world have made changes on design wave loads' value and fatigue influence factor modification due to the influence of springing and whipping on ultra-large containerships.The paper firstly introduced 3-D linear hydroelastic theory in frequency domain and 3-D nonlinear hydroelastic theory in time domain, considering large amplitude motion nonlinearity and slamming force due to the severe relative motion between ship hull and wave. Then the spectrum analysis method and time domain statistical analysis method were introduced, which can make fatigue analysis under a series of standard steps in frequency and time domain, respectively. Finally, discussions on the influence factor of springing and whipping on fatigue damages of 8500 TEU and 10000 TEU containerships with different loading states were made. The fatigue assessment of different position on the midship section was done on the basis of nominal stress. The fatigue damage due to whipping can be the same as the fatigue damage due to springing and even sometimes can be larger than the springing damage. Besides, some suggestions on calculating load case selection were made to minimize the quantity of work in frequency and time domain. Thus, tools for fatigue influence factor modification were provided to meet the demand of IACS-UR. 展开更多

Dry whip motion is an instability of rubbing rotor system and may cause catastrophic failures of rotating machinery.Up to now,the related mechanisms of the dry whip is still not well understood.This paper aims to build the relationship between the complex nonlinear modes and the dry whip motion,and propose an effective method to predict the response characteristics and existence boundary of the dry whip through complex nonlinear modes.For the first time,the paper discusses how to use the complex nonlinear modes to predict the dry whip systematically,and as a consequence,the mechanism of the relationship between the complex nonlinear mode and the dry whip is revealed.The results show that the Backward Whirl(BW)mode motion of the rubbing rotor system dominates the response characteristics and the existence boundary of dry whip.The whirl amplitude and whirl frequency of dry whip are equal to the modal amplitude and modal frequency of the BW mode at the jump up point where the modal damping is equal to zero.The existence boundary corresponds to the critical rotation speed where the minimum of the modal damping of the BW mode motion is exactly equal to zero.Moreover,the proposed nonlinear modal method in this article is very effective for the prediction of dry whip of the more complicated practical rotor system,which has been verified by applying the predicted method into a rubbing rotor test rig. 展开更多

Many industrial applications and experiments have shown that sliding bearings often experience fluid film whip due to nonlinear fluid film forces which can cause rotor-stator rub-impact failures. The oil-film whips have attracted many studies while the water-film whips in the water lubricated sliding bearing have been little researched with the mechanism still an open problem. The dynamic fluid film forces in a water sliding bearing are investigated numerically with rotational, whirling and squeezing motions of the journal using a nonlinear model to identify the relationships between the three motions. Rotor speed-up and slow-down experiments are then conducted with the rotor system supported by a water lubricated sliding bearing to induce the water-film whirl/whip and verify the relationship. The experimental results show that the vibrations of the journal alternated between increasing and decreasing rather than continuously increasing as the rotational speed increased to twice the first critical speed, which can be explained well by the nonlinear model. The radial growth rate of the whirl motion greatly affects the whirl frequency of the journal and is responsible for the frequency lock in the water-film whip. Further analysis shows that increasing the lubricating water flow rate changes the water-film whirl/whip characteristics, reduces the first critical speed, advances the time when significant water-film whirling motion occurs, and also increases the vibration amplitude at the bearing center which may lead to the rotor-stator rub-impact. The study gives the insight into the water-film whirl and whip in the water lubricated sliding bearing. 展开更多

The experimental research on protection capability of the flying-whip multifunctional explosive reactive armor (ERA) was performed, in which the comparison experiment was made on the damage effect of the flying-whip's geometrical figuration, material property and driven velocity on the long-rod armor-piercing-projectile. The moving velocity of the flying-whip driven by different explosives and the pressure attenuation law of shock wave travelling in the back plate were measured respectively with the electric probe method and the manganin piezoresistive gauge technique. The following conclusions based on a great quantity of experimental data were drawn: compared with the sandwich ERA the flying-whip multifunctional ERA has very good protection function against the long-rod armor-piercing-projectile, the shaped charge warhead and the anti-armor tandem warhead. In addition, the composite plate made of the armor-steel and rubber plate can lessen the vibration and shock of the main armor caused by the explosion of the charge.. 展开更多

旨在解决植脂搅打稀奶油反式脂肪酸含量较高的问题,以初榨椰子油为油相制备零反式脂肪酸植脂搅打稀奶油,研究其添加量(28%~36%)对稀奶油搅打前后品质的影响,并与市售植脂稀奶油打发后的样品进行质构特性、裱花形态及感官品质方面的对比... 旨在解决植脂搅打稀奶油反式脂肪酸含量较高的问题,以初榨椰子油为油相制备零反式脂肪酸植脂搅打稀奶油,研究其添加量(28%~36%)对稀奶油搅打前后品质的影响,并与市售植脂稀奶油打发后的样品进行质构特性、裱花形态及感官品质方面的对比。结果表明,随着初榨椰子油添加量的增加,稀奶油搅打时间逐渐缩短,搅打起泡率和泡沫稳定性呈现先增大后减小的趋势,表观黏度增大,搅打稀奶油脂肪球体积平均粒径、脂肪部分聚结率增大。最适初榨椰子油添加量为32%,此时稀奶油搅打时间为122 s,搅打起泡率最高(95.86%),泡沫稳定性最佳(94.58%),搅打稀奶油质构特性(硬度、内聚性、弹性、胶黏性、咀嚼性)和感官得分与市售植脂稀奶油打发后的样品均无显著差异,搅打稀奶油裱花后具有锋利的边缘和坚挺的峰,25℃放置1 h后无乳清析出现象,且未检出反式脂肪酸。综上,以初榨椰子油为油相制备植脂搅打稀奶油,克服了传统植脂搅打稀奶油反式脂肪酸含量较高的问题,可满足消费者对营养和健康的追求。 展开更多

为解决无水奶油制备的搅打稀奶油风味不佳的问题,该研究通过无水奶油与新鲜稀奶油复配制备一种新型再制稀奶油。通过测定稀奶油搅打性能、流变、稳定性、微观结构及风味等指标,研究不同无水奶油添加量(0%、10%、20%、30%,质量分数)对稀... 为解决无水奶油制备的搅打稀奶油风味不佳的问题,该研究通过无水奶油与新鲜稀奶油复配制备一种新型再制稀奶油。通过测定稀奶油搅打性能、流变、稳定性、微观结构及风味等指标,研究不同无水奶油添加量(0%、10%、20%、30%,质量分数)对稀奶油的品质影响,确定无水奶油最适添加用量。结果表明,不同无水奶油添加量对稀奶油影响显著。随着无水奶油添加比例的提高,表观黏度逐渐增大(从0.29 mPa·s到0.75 mPa·s),泡沫硬度升高(从1107 g到1288 g),起泡率趋于下降(从196%到147%),打发时间也逐渐缩短(从225 s到192 s),Zeta电位绝对值先增大后减小,稳定性呈先升高后降低趋势,风味偏向于只添加无水奶油的样品。综合考虑,当无水奶油添加比例为20%时,脂肪球分布均匀,可保证稀奶油体系的稳定性,搅打性能良好,且风味较纯无水奶油基稀奶油更佳。 展开更多

为明确不同脂肪酸组成和结晶特性的油脂与搅打奶油乳液的冻融稳定性及搅打特性之间的内在联系,本实验研究了棕榈仁油(palm kernel oil,PKO)、全氢化棕榈仁油(fully hydrogenated palm kernel oil,FHPKO)、棕榈仁硬脂(palm kernel steari... 为明确不同脂肪酸组成和结晶特性的油脂与搅打奶油乳液的冻融稳定性及搅打特性之间的内在联系,本实验研究了棕榈仁油(palm kernel oil,PKO)、全氢化棕榈仁油(fully hydrogenated palm kernel oil,FHPKO)、棕榈仁硬脂(palm kernel stearin,PKS)和棕榈油硬脂(palm oil stearin,POS)的油脂组成与结晶特性对分别经过1、3、5次冻融循环植脂搅打奶油品质的影响。研究发现,在冻融循环下由月桂酸型油脂制备的乳液稳定性和搅打特性整体上优于棕榈酸型油脂。对于月桂酸型油脂,发现碳十八链长的脂肪酸占比越高,乳液稳定性和搅打性能越好。油酸(C_(18:1))含量较多的PKO起始融化温度最低,形成的脂肪结晶小且热稳定差;经过5次冻融循环后,以PKO为原料制备的乳液稳定性最强,打发倍数较高,但奶油放置6 h后高度明显下降。硬脂酸(C_(18:0))含量较高的FHPKO形成的脂肪结晶小且紧密,经过5次冻融循环后乳液界面蛋白占比略微降低,所制备的乳液具有较强的稳定性,打发倍数最高,充气稳定性最强。然而,豆蔻酸(C_(14:0))含量较多的PKS形成细小的颗粒状结晶,脂肪球部分聚结最严重,导致乳液黏度和粒径最大,打发倍数最小,奶油出现析水现象。对于棕榈酸型油脂,以棕榈酸(C_(16:0))为主要脂肪酸的POS起始融化温度最高,能够形成粗大的油脂结晶,经过5次冻融循环后乳液界面蛋白占比最低,脂肪部分聚结率高,所制备的乳液不稳定,打发倍数低,奶油出现析水现象。本研究可为生产具有高冻融稳定性和优质打发特性的搅打奶油提供理论支持。 展开更多
